Mixed integer programming method to solve security constrained unit commitment with restricted operating zone limits

TL;DR: Non-convex characteristic of generator cost function, representing prohibited operating zones is considered in SCUC, a formulation of security-constrained unit commitment problem based on mixed integer programming (MIP) method.

Long-term load forecasting in electricity market

TL;DR: Two approaches based regression method and artificial neural network for long-term load forecast are introduced and fuzzy sets to ANN are applied for modeling long- term uncertainties and the enhanced forecasting results are compared with those of traditional methods.

Fuzzy mixed integer programming: Approach to security-constrained unit commitment

TL;DR: A formulation of fuzzy mixed integer programming (FMIP) solution for solving security-constrained unit commitment (SCUC) problem with emphasis on uncertainties in forecasted parameters in constraints is presented.
